Even at the age of 30, Robert Lewandowski comes with a hefty price tag. Prized possession of German giants Bayern Munich, Lewandowski has itchy feet, reports the Sun.

He is flirting with the idea of playing in top-flight English football, toying with a move to the Premier League at the end of the season.

With 97 league goals in nearly four seasons at Bayern, plus another 74 in a similar time frame at Borussia Dortmund, the effective foward has done his bit in the Bundesliga.

A fresh challenge is said to excite him. English football’s top clubs will be all over him from now on.

If Lewandowski can persuade Bayern to release him from a contract that runs to 2021, the scramble will be on. 

In the monied and frenzied modern era, this fellow is a must-get. There is a growing feeling this could be his last year in Germany.
